Outline of Final Research Achievements

Photoresponsive malachite green copolymer has been designed to induce the formation of G-quadruplex by light. The interaction of the copolymer with d[(TTAGGG)4] oligonucleotide has been investigated by fluorescence analysis. Circular dichroism spectroscopies revealed that irradiation of the mixture of the copolymer and d[(TTAGGG)4] leads to the formation of antiparallel G-quadruplex. The results of competition dialysis assay indicated that the binding of malachite green to G-quadruplex of d[(TTAGGG)4] was selective. The G-quadruplex structure was found to be stabilized by the binding of malachite green.
